Vinod K V commented on HADOOP-5420:
-----------------------------------
Looked at the patch. I think we should set the default value for
_mapred.tasktracker.tasks.sleeptime-before-sigkill_ to be 5 seconds in the
taskcontroller.cfg itself so that it serves as a source of documentation for
the default value.
Another point that may be the content of another JIRA, The issue, though not
directly related to this patch, but that gets a bit amplified with this patch
is the fact that we have a separate configuration for task-controller.
_mapred.tasktracker.tasks.sleeptime-before-sigkill_ is already provided via
mapred configuration and admins will have two places to chose depending on the
task-controller in use. Further, in the current code, this parameter is job
configurable and as part of HADOOP-5614, Ravi is planning to have a job
configurable _mapred.job.tasks.sleeptime-before-sigkill_ and a TT level
_mapred.job.tasks.sleeptime-before-sigkill_.
